School Raps McCain For Using

School Raps McCain For Using Image As Speech Backdrop Without Permission
By Kate Klonick - September 5, 2008, 4:32PM
Okay, the McCain-Walter Reed Middle School backdrop debacle is getting weirder by the second. Now the principal of the school is hammering McCain for using footage of the school during his convention speech without seeking the school's permission.

Here's the statement from Donna Tobin, the principal...

"It has been brought to the school's attention that a picture of the front of our school, Walter Reed Middle School, was used as a backdrop at the Republican National Convention. Permission to use the front of our school for the Republican National Convention was not given by our school nor is the use of our school's picture an endorsement of any political party or view."
One other interesting development: The California Democratic Party is actually holding a press conference in front of the school within minutes, where Dems will hit McCain for not knowing the difference between the school and Walter Reed Medical Center, which is believed to be the backdrop the McCain campaign really wanted.

Though multiple news organizations are asking for clarification, the McCain campaign is still refusing to comment on questions about whether it had hoped to use the medical center as a backdrop and accidentally used the school instead. Hard to blame them...

In operant conditioning, extinction is the withholding of reinforcement for a previously reinforced behavior which decreases the future probability of that behavior. For example, a child who climbs under his desk, a response which has been reinforced by attention, is subsequently ignored until the attention-seeking behavior no longer occurs. In his autobiography, B. F. Skinner noted how he accidentally discovered the extinction of an operant response due to the malfunction of his laboratory equipment.

My first extinction curve showed up by accident. A rat was pressing the lever in an experiment on satiation when the pellet dispenser jammed. I was not there at the time, and when I returned I found a beautiful curve. The rat had gone on pressing although no pellets were received.... The change was more orderly than the extinction of a salivary reflex in Pavlov’s setting, and I was terribly excited. It was a Friday afternoon and there was no one in the laboratory who I could tell. All that weekend I crossed streets with particular care and avoided all unnecessary risks to protect my discovery from loss through my accidental death.[1]
When the extinction of a response has occurred, the discriminative stimulus is then known as an extinction stimulus (SΔ or s delta). When an S delta is present, the reinforcing consequence which characteristically follows a behavior does not occur. This is the opposite of a discriminative stimulus which is a signal that reinforcement will occur. For instance, in an operant chamber, if food pellets are only delivered when a response is emitted in the presence of a green light, the green light is a discriminative stimulus. If when a red light is present food will not be delivered, then the red light is an extinction stimulus. (food here is used as an example of a reinforcer).

extinction Burst:

While extinction, when implemented consistently over time, results in the eventual decrease of the undesired behavior, in the near-term the subject might exhibit what is called an extinction burst. An extinction burst will often occur when the extinction procedure has just begun. This consists of a sudden and temporary increase in the response's frequency, followed by the eventual decline and extinction of the behavior targeted for elimination.

Take, as an example, a pigeon that has been reinforced to peck an electronic button. During its training history, every time the pigeon pecked the button, it will have received a small amount of bird seed as a reinforcer. So, whenever the bird is hungry, it will peck the button to receive food. However, if the button were to be turned off, the hungry pigeon will first try pecking the button just as it has in the past. When no food is forthcoming, the bird will likely try again... and again, and again. After a period of frantic activity, in which their pecking behavior yields no result, the pigeon's pecking will decrease in frequency.

The evolutionary advantage of this extinction burst is clear. In a natural environment, an animal that persists in a learned behavior, despite not resulting in immediate reinforcement, might still have a chance of producing reinforcing consequences if they try again. This animal would be at an advantage over another animal that gives up too easily.

The discipline we lack-

GOP orchestrated delegates' comments on Palin

ST. PAUL, Minn. — Alaska delegates to the Republican National Convention got a strong message this week from Republican officials as the media swarm kept bugging them about Gov. Sarah Palin: "STAY POSITIVE when talking with reporters."

Despite the fact that the Republicans met in Minnesota to nominate John McCain for president, there was more discipline than straight talk at their convention. Day after day, it was hard to find anyone who wasn't offering the same lines, and as delegates and officials headed home Friday, they were confident that they could answer any question about Palin or anything else quickly and cogently.

The message effort proceeded on several fronts. Party officials participated in daily conference calls with top Republicans and discussed the "line of the day," usually how to discuss energy, McCain's record, the economy or national security. Surrogates then talked to the news media and delegate meetings.

On the convention floor, the national party on Monday gave all delegates blue pocket cards listing party principles, with quick responses to constituent and media questions.

For instance, should anyone ask about the economy or terrorism, they could repeat lines such as: "We support our heroes and their mission to create an enduring peace, based on freedom and the will to defend it."

Kremlin-watchers warn of direct U.S.-Russia clash
By Tom Lasseter | McClatchy Newspapers

MOSCOW_ In the aftermath of last month's war between Russia and U.S.-backed Georgia, Kremlin-watchers in Moscow are worried that Russia and America are closer to direct confrontation than at any point since the end of the Cold War.

The rhetoric coming from the Bush administration — and presidential hopeful John McCain — suggests that tensions are still on the rise.

During the Cold War, "the sides were very careful of each other. They were careful not to come too close," said Alexander Pikayev, a prominent military analyst in Moscow who works for a government-funded research center. "The risk of direct military clashes is (now) much higher. . . . This situation is much riskier than the Cold War."

Russian analysts say there are three possible flash points, all centered on or around the Black Sea, once almost lakefront property for the Soviet empire. The sea borders three NATO members — Turkey, Bulgaria and Romania — and two applicants, Georgia and Ukraine. If the two applicants join the alliance, Russia's Black Sea coastline would be surrounded by NATO.

"Now it looks like there is a certain red line that exists in the heads of Russian leadership and they are willing to do anything to stop it from being crossed," said Nikolai Petrov, a Moscow scholar in residence with the Carnegie Endowment for International Peace. "And this red line is Ukraine and Georgia joining NATO."

Bomb targets Chalabi in

Bomb targets Chalabi in Iraq
Posted: 05:05 PM ET
BAGHDAD, Iraq (CNN) — A suicide car bomb targeting Shiite politician Ahmed Chalabi killed two people and injured at least 17 Friday in western Baghdad, Iraq’s Interior Ministry said.

The Interior Ministry said the car bombing happened near Chalabi’s home in Baghdad’s al-Mansour district. Chalabi escaped unharmed, it said.

At least one of the people killed was a civilian and authorities were uncertain Friday whether the other fatality was a civilian or a member of Chalabi’s security detail.

Earlier, Defense Ministry adviser Abdul Amir Hassan was shot dead when he was driving near his home in east Baghdad. Guns equipped with silencers were used in that attack.

Harassing Gas

Harassing Gas

http://www.seattleweekly.com/2008-09-03/news/harassing-gas/

A Green Party gubernatorial candidate rings a biodiesel merchant’s bell, and gets accused of criminal behavior for it.

Last fall, Propel Biofuels opened its first Seattle fueling station at Bernie's Automotive in Ballard. The event drew the usual suspects: Propel CEO Rob Elam, Sen. Maria Cantwell, a canola farmer from eastern Washington, and Duff Badgley, head of One Earth, a locally-based group dedicated to fighting climate change. At the opening, Badgley, who thinks biofuel isn't sustainable unless it's made from recycled vegetable oil, let it be known he was highly suspicious of what constituted the biodiesel coursing through Propel's bright green pump.

In the months that followed, Badgley—who until his primary loss was a Green Party candidate for governor—began showing up every few weeks at the Ballard Propel station with other members of One Earth and a banner reading "Biofuel = Crimes Against Humanity." But they didn't stop there: Elam says that One Earth protesters have been approaching customers—particularly women—and harassing them while they fill up, and that this practice has spread to another recently-opened station on West Mercer Street. Here, the One Earthers hand out leaflets charging biofuels with being a "scourge on humankind," and allegedly take photos of customers and their license plates.

"Crimes against humanity, really?" says Elam. "In all likelihood, this is the most sustainable and local fuel that's been available. This intense hostility is against something that doesn't exist...Where it crosses the line is when he starts intimidating customers." (In actuality, it's pretty tough to find a Propel customer to harass these days. Recent hour-long visits to Propel's South Lake Union and Ballard stations yielded just one customer in toto: Heather Andersen, who insists protesters won't scare her away.)

Like his protests, Badgley's beef with biodiesel has evolved. Initially he was concerned about only biodiesel made with palm oil—which some feel contributes to the destruction of rain forests—and questioned whether one of Propel's sources, Imperium Renewables of Grays Harbor, was importing its oil from Malaysia. Now Badgley's against all "crop-based" biodiesel, meaning soy, canola, and pretty much anything not made from recycled oil.

Badgley argues that soy and canola seed, although grown in North America, contribute to rain forest destruction because the growing demand for biodiesel encourages farmers to plant in more tropical locations. Badgley also claims soy and canola grown for fuel are displacing acreage farmed for food, and therefore contributing to rising prices and hunger worldwide. Meanwhile, Elam says Propel, which has six stations in Washington and plans to expand into Oregon and California, gets its fuel from canola seed grown in Washington and Canada.

Balls found inside 'rattling' dog

Balls found inside 'rattling' dog

http://news.bbc.co.uk/2/hi/uk_news/scotland/edinburgh_and_east/7599899.s...

A dog had to have 13 golf balls removed from its stomach after eating them on walks around a Fife course.

Owner Chris Morrison had been taking five-year-old black labrador Oscar round the Pitreavie golf course in Dunfermline for several months.

He took Oscar to the vet after noticing a rattling sound coming from his pet's stomach.

They then discovered that 13 balls - each weighing 45 grams - were lodged in his stomach.

Mr Morrison, a planning administrator, said one of the balls had been in his stomach so long that it had turned black and was decomposing.

He said: "He finds golf balls like truffles. We're not sure how long exactly this happened over, but it must have been a fair period - several months at least.

"I felt his stomach and heard them rattling around.

"He normally brings a few home, but I had no idea he had eaten so many.

"The vet hadn't seen anything like it, it was bizarre.

"He is a black lab so he is a fair size, but to swallow 13 is quite amazing."

The balls were removed two weeks ago in a successful hour-long operation.

Bag full

Oscar is now on the road to making a full recovery on a special post-operation diet of watered-down food.

He also has to wear a muzzle while out and about.

Mr Morrison added: "He does get a bit frustrated now and again."

Bob Hesketh, 40, principal vet at Vetrica in Rosyth, said he had never seen anything like it.

He said: "It was like a magic trick. I opened him up and felt what I thought was two or three golf balls.

"But they just kept coming until we had a bag full.

"I think they must have been in there for several months, one was all black and the shell was swollen."

Palin Approval Runs Along Partisan Lines

About half of the public had a favorable first impression of vice-presidential nominee Sarah Palin, and that half consists primarily of Republicans, a new ABC News poll finds. This not-so-shocking divide mirrors the numbers on Joe Biden: his candidacy makes 22% of people more likely to support the Obama ticket and 10% less likely.

McCain's choice inspired increased confidence in 80% of Republicans and 44% of independents, while 59% of Democrats report less confidence in the senator's ability to make important decisions. Men are more confident than women (46% to 39%) that Palin has enough experience to be president, with a wider gap on the question of whether the media have treated her fairly—46% of women say yes, to 55% of men.
